Tải bản đầy đủ (.pptx) (25 trang)

Bài báo cáo kỹ thuật phần mềm

Bạn đang xem bản rút gọn của tài liệu. Xem và tải ngay bản đầy đủ của tài liệu tại đây (5.67 MB, 25 trang )

Bài báo cáo
Môn: Phân tích yêu cầu phần mềm

Chủ đề: xây dựng hệ thống quản lý cửa hàng linh
kiện máy tính

Xin chào thầy và các bạn!
Giảng viên: Lê Xuân Nghị


Thành viên
Phạm Trí Thịnh
Nguyễn Tấn Toại
Đỗ Trần Hà Giang
Huỳnh Phước Thái
Phan Thành Công


Nội dung

1.Giới thiệu hệ thống
2.Tính khả thi của hệ thống
3.Mô tả bài toán
4.Xây dựng sơ đồ USE CASE
5.Xây dựng sơ đồ lớp
6.Xây dựng sơ đồ quan hệ thực thể
7.Kết luận


1. Giới thiệu



Nội dung

1.Giới thiệu hệ thống
2.Tính khả thi của phần mềm
3.Mô tả bài toán
4.Xây dựng sơ đồ USE CASE
5.Xây dựng sơ đồ lớp
6.Xây dựng sơ đồ quan hệ thực thể
7.Kết luận


Tính khả thi của phần mềm

Khả thi về kinh tế.

Khả thi về vận hành

Khả thi về kỹ thuật.


Khả thi về kinh tế.

Sản phẩm phần mềm được hỗ trợ bởi 2 công cụ Visual studio
2012 và SQL sever 2014
Chi phí bảo trì phần mềm gần như không có.
Giảm thiểu thời gian quản lý, giúp quản lý linh hoạt hơn, giảm
tải đội ngũ nhân viên do đó có thể giúp doanh thu tăng.
Tạo sự hài lòng, uy tín cho khách hàng



Khả thi về vận hành

Phần mềm sau khi hoàn thành sẽ được quản lý và nhân viên trong
các nghiệp vụ bán hàng
Phần mềm có thể phân quyền cho người sử dụng
Sản phẩm mới vẫn đáp ứng các yêu cầu đặt ra của khách sạn khi
được mở rộng trong tương lai.


Khả thi về kỹ thuật.

Sản phẩm phát triển bởi 2 ngôn ngữ chính C# và CSDL SQL
là những ngôn ngữ tối ưu hỗ trợ để đảm bảo tính khả thi về kỹ
thuật
Sản phẩm được thiết kế chạy trên nền hệ điều hành
window đảm bảo phù hợp với đa số người dùng.


Nội dung

1.Giới thiệu hệ thống
2.Tính khả thi của phần mềm
3.Mô tả bài toán
4.Xây dựng sơ đồ USE CASE
5.Xây dựng sơ đồ lớp
6.Xây dựng sơ đồ quan hệ thực thể
7.Kết luận



2. Mô tả bài toán
Khi
Khi có
có yêu
yêu cầu
cầu nhập
nhập thiết
thiết bị
bị linh
linh kiện:
kiện: nhân
nhân viên
viên tiến
tiến hành
hành ghi
ghi phiếu
phiếu yêu
yêu cầu
cầu gồm
gồm các
các thông
thông tin
tin chi
chi tiết
tiết về
về
thiết
thiết bị
bị và
và gửi

gửi sang
sang nhà
nhà cung
cung cấp
cấp
Nhà
Nhà cung
cung cấp
cấp sẽ
sẽ gửi
gửi đơn
đơn hàng
hàng chi
chi tiết
tiết về
về các
các thiết
thiết bị
bị bao
bao gồm
gồm các
các thông
thông tin
tin như:
như: tên,
tên, loại
loại thiết
thiết bị,
bị, số
số

lượng,
lượng, nguồn
nguồn gốc,…
gốc,… Qua
Qua đơn
đơn hàng
hàng của
của nhà
nhà cung
cung cấp
cấp thì
thì cửa
cửa hàng
hàng sẽ
sẽ đưa
đưa ra
ra đơn
đơn đặt
đặt hàng
hàng và
và gửi
gửi cho
cho nhà
nhà cung
cung
cấp,
cấp, để
để có
có thể
thể đáp

đáp ứng
ứng nhu
nhu cầu
cầu nhập
nhập thiết
thiết bị
bị của
của cửa
cửa hàng
hàng và
và nhà
nhà cung
cung cấp
cấp sẽ
sẽ chuyển
chuyển thiết
thiết bị
bị cho
cho cửa
cửa hàng
hàng
theo
theo hợp
hợp đồng
đồng mua,
mua, bán
bán hàng
hàng và
và biên
biên lai

lai bàn
bàn giao
giao thiết
thiết bị
bị (kiểm
(kiểm hóa
hóa đơn
đơn thanh
thanh toán
toán tiền
tiền thiết
thiết bị).
bị).
Trước
Trước khi
khi nhập
nhập hàng
hàng vào
vào kho
kho thì
thì cửa
cửa hàng
hàng sẽ
sẽ kiểm
kiểm tra
tra xem
xem đã
đã đủ
đủ thiết
thiết bị

bị chưa
chưa theo
theo biên
biên lai
lai bàn
bàn giao
giao thiết
thiết
bị
bị mà
mà nhà
nhà cung
cung cấp
cấp gửi
gửi đến,
đến, đồng
đồng thời
thời cửa
cửa hàng
hàng sẽ
sẽ ghi
ghi các
các thông
thông tin
tin cần
cần thiết
thiết vào
vào sổ
sổ ghi
ghi và

và sổ
sổ kho.
kho. Nếu
Nếu thiết
thiết bị
bị
nào
nào không
không đạt
đạt yêu
yêu cầu
cầu thì
thì cửa
cửa hàng
hàng sẽ
sẽ trả
trả lại
lại nhà
nhà cung
cung cấp
cấp và
và yêu
yêu cầu
cầu nhà
nhà cung
cung cấp
cấp nhập
nhập các
các mặt
mặt hàng

hàng lại
lại như
như
đã
đã thỏa
thỏa thuận
thuận trong
trong hợp
hợp đồng.
đồng.


2. Mô tả bài toán
Tìm hàng

Thanh toán, in
hóa đơn

Sả

hẩ
nP

S

ã


T
m,

tìm

ng


tin

Phân phối SP


Nội dung

1.Giới thiệu hệ thống
2.Tính khả thi của hệ thống
3.Mô tả bài toán
4.Xây dựng sơ đồ USE CASE
5.Xây dựng sơ đồ lớp
6.Xây dựng sơ đồ quan hệ thực thể
7.Kết luận


Xây dựng sơ đồ USE CASE

C á c h x ây d ự n g s ơ đ ồ U S E C A S E:
1. Xác Định lớp từ USE CASE
- xét từ bài toán quản lý bán hàng:
+ nếu là USE CASE xác định động từ cụm động từ
+ nếu là Actor xác định người trực tiếp sử dụng phần mềm
2. Xác Định phương thức và một số thuộc tính cợ bản
- Từ các lớp xác định có thể thấy một số thuộc tính và phương thức

cơ bản như lớp khách hàng thì thuộc tính như: Mã khách hàng, tên
khách hàng, địa chỉ, SDT…


Xây dựng

Sơ đồ tổng quát

Dựa vào yêu cầu bài toán quản lý bán
hàng ta thấy tác nhân chính là khách
hàng và nhân viên


Sơ đồ chi tiết


Nội dung

1.Giới thiệu hệ thống
2.Tính khả thi của hệ thống
3.Mô tả bài toán
4.Xây dựng sơ đồ USE CASE
5.Xây dựng sơ đồ lớp
6.Xây dựng sơ đồ quan hệ thực thể
7.Kết luận


Kết quả xây dựng sơ đồ lớp



Sơ đồ CSDL


Nội dung

1.Giới thiệu hệ thống
2.Tính khả thi của hệ thống
3.Mô tả bài toán
4.Xây dựng sơ đồ USE CASE
5.Xây dựng sơ đồ lớp
6.Xây dựng sơ đồ quan hệ thực thể
7.Kết luận


3

Xác định rõ kiểu các lớp thuộc tính tham gia trong tương tác Ví dụ: giao diện điều



1

Xác định thực thể tìm những động từ trong bài toán



2

Tìm mối quan hệ giữa thuộc tính và thực thể




xây dựng sơ đồ tuần tự

khiển hay thực tế


Kết quả xây dựng sơ đồ quan hệ thực thể


Nội dung

1.Giới thiệu hệ thống
2.Tính khả thi của hệ thống
3.Mô tả bài toán
4.Xây dựng sơ đồ USE CASE
5.Xây dựng sơ đồ lớp
6.Xây dựng sơ đồ quan hệ thực thể
7.Kết luận


Kết luận

 Nhìn chung việc áp dụng công nghệ thông tin vào
quản lý ở các công ty đã trở nên phồ biến và ngày
càng quan trong trong việc kinh doanh cho nhiều
công ty lớn nhỏ, nó đã đóng góp rất nhiều cho việc
tính giảm nhân sự và giúp hệ thống cửa hàng linh
kiện có thể làm việc đạt được hiệu quả cao.



Cảm ơn thầy và các bạn lắng nghe !


×